    What is e-commerce

    E-commerce, also known as e-commerce, it is the practice of conducting commercial transactions over the internet. This includes the buying and selling of products, online services and information. E-commerce has revolutionized the way companies conduct their business and how consumers acquire goods and services

    History

    E-commerce began to gain popularity in the 1990s, with the advent of the World Wide Web. At the beginning, online transactions were mainly limited to the sale of books, CDs and software. Over time, as technology advanced and consumer confidence in e-commerce grew, more companies started to offer a wide range of products and services online

    Types of e-commerce

    There are several types of e-commerce, including

    1. Business-to-Consumer (B2C): Involves the sale of products or services directly to end consumers

    2. Business-to-Business (B2B): It occurs when one company sells products or services to another company

    3. Consumer-to-Consumer (C2C): Allows consumers to sell products or services directly to each other, usually through online platforms like eBay or OLX

    4. Consumer-to-Business (C2B): Involves consumers who offer products or services to businesses, as freelancers offering their services through platforms like Fiverr or 99Freelas

    Advantages

    E-commerce offers several advantages for businesses and consumers, such as

    1. Convenience: Consumers can purchase products or services at any time and from anywhere, since they have access to the internet

    2. Wide variety: Online stores usually offer a much broader selection of products than physical stores

    3. Price comparison: Consumers can easily compare prices from different suppliers to find the best deals

    4. Reduced costs: Companies can save on operational costs, such as renting physical space and employees, when selling online

    5. Global reach: E-commerce allows companies to reach a much wider audience than would be possible with a physical store

    Challenges

    Despite its many advantages, e-commerce also presents some challenges, including

    1. Security: The protection of consumers' financial and personal data is a constant concern in e-commerce

    2. Logistics: Ensure that products are delivered quickly, efficient and reliable can be a challenge, especially for smaller companies

    3. Fierce competition: With so many companies selling online, it can be difficult to stand out and attract customers

    4. Trust issues: Some consumers still hesitate to shop online due to concerns about fraud and the inability to see and touch products before buying them

    Future of e-commerce

    As technology continues to advance and more people around the world gain access to the internet, e-commerce is expected to continue to grow and evolve. Some trends that are expected to shape the future of e-commerce include

    1. Mobile shopping: More and more consumers are using their smartphones and tablets to shop online

    2. Personalization: Companies are using data and artificial intelligence to provide consumers with more personalized shopping experiences

    3. Augmented reality: Some companies are experimenting with augmented reality to allow consumers to virtually "try on" products before purchasing

    4. Digital payments: As digital payment options, such as electronic wallets and cryptocurrencies, become more popular, they should become even more integrated into e-commerce
